I prefer stiffer plates, so FR4 or CF
is it true that overdoing foams can cause issues with key registering etc?
if i were to order torontokeyboardman foams kit, do you know how to avoid it?
This for example. They always include this foam in mod kits, you don't want to use that, if you care about performance
its a guaranteed decrease by just putting it in?
It's guaranteed to increase deadzone, make the accuracy worse etc. Anything soft between the PCB and plate is bad
if you include everything that give you in the kit it leaves almost no space in the case as well, people have reported boards bending, usually with the stiffer plates
what about something under pcb
you need to have some room in the case for the board to flex, or you risk damaging the pcb
i saw people putting few pet films, custom foams, layers of tape. is that dangerous then?
not at all, pet films are really thin, and the foam is fine as long as its under the board since it will flex, tape layers are also really thin. the modkit comes with foam, plate, pet film, switch foam, case foam, 2 layers of tape, gasket foam, and some other foam to add
the mod kit comes with so much to add that it leaves almost no room for the board to move, thats what can affect your performance and damage the board

i see that for example pc plate is softer than fr4. is it really noticeable or you need to press hard for it etc?
it doesn't really change how you press it, its more of how the pcb flexes when you press a key, a stiffer plate will have less of a flex when you press a key down
how would those plate compare to mainstream gaming keyboards? i dont see it mentioned there, probably they use other type of assembly?
for example what would be a plate equivalent of some logitech board
usually some sort of aluminum or steel iirc
steel is more of a clacky sound while aluminum is more of a thock
what mods are you personally running on your 80he?
metal will always be stiffer, louder, and more resonant
plastic is usually softer, quieter, and more flexible
composite plates like FR4 or CF are usually a middle ground between the two

ABS is a softer plastic compared to PBT
That might just be a manufacturing defect
Drop is also ABS
ABS softer, easier formed, more prone to issues like that in the image, eventually shines from fingerprint oil
PBT harder, more likely to defect in forming process especially spacebars, better hold up long run, no shine

Hello Wooting Team, I'm making a custom coiled cable for my 80he and I need some information if possible. What type of Type C and specifications are needed for it to support 8K pollin rate, (My first try was a fail as it only worked with 1k polling rate)
If this isnt the correct place please redirect me where to ask. Thanks.
Uh... USB 2.0

That's all you need for 8khz polling. Beyond that it's just a question of good soldering, quality wiring and not making a super long cable.
Made a 1.5m with 17cm coiled part, thick wires. Type C on both end.
And what happens when you enable 8khz polling in Wootility?
USB Device malfunctioning popup on windows, if I change it while its plugged in. Same if it 8k beforehand
Works on 8k ducky board but that one probably needs less power. Power delivery should be 5V2A or more?
Which kind of gauge is it needed? 22 24 26 28?
ihaswooting

if you assume it is power maybe try turning off the LEDs on the wooting to get it to be a bit lower at least
Tried with turned off LEDs and Bar, only 8k without tachyon, still nothing doesnt even recongize it if its set to 8k, need to use the stock cable to reset it to 1k to continue
The signaling on USB high speed is a lot more sensitive to voltage drops
